MGPI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

207 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in MGP Ingredients (MGPI)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$1.44B — up 32% from $1.09B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 50 funds opened new MGPI posit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 33 holders — while 53 added to existing stakes and 66 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Macquarie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$16.5M. The largest seller was Copeland Capital Management, cutting an estimated $37.9M.
